How Navigating the System with a Hennepin County Public Defender Actually Works
To understand Navigating the System with a Hennepin County Public Defender, it helps to know the basic steps from arrest to resolution. When someone is charged with a crime and cannot afford a private attorney, the court may assign a public defender from the countyโs office. This defender is a licensed attorney employed or contracted by the county to provide legal representation at little or no cost to the client. The process includes initial court appearances, case reviews, plea discussions, and, if needed, trial preparation.
For example, imagine a resident is charged with a traffic-related offense and cannot pay for a lawyer. After the arrest, they appear before a judge, request a public defender, and are assigned an attorney through Hennepin Countyโs system. That attorney then reviews the charges, explains possible outcomes, gathers evidence, and negotiates with prosecutors on the clientโs behalf. Common Questions People Have About Navigating the System with a Hennepin County Public Defender
Who qualifies for a public defender in Hennepin County?
Eligibility is generally based on income and case type. The court reviews financial information during the first appearance to determine whether the defendant can afford private counsel. If not, a public defender is appointed. This ensures that even those with limited funds have professional support. The system is designed to prevent people from facing serious charges without any legal help.
What services does a public defender provide?
A public defender handles all basic legal work needed to build a defense. This includes filing motions, interviewing witnesses, negotiating with prosecutors, and representing the client in court. They often manage heavy caseloads, but they are required to meet professional standards. Can I request a different attorney if I am not satisfied?
In some situations, a defendant may ask for replacement if there is a clear conflict of interest or a serious problem with representation. Judges typically decide whether such requests are granted. Most clients work closely with their assigned defender throughout the process. Opportunities and Considerations
Using public defense services offers several practical benefits, especially for people with tight budgets. It removes the barrier of high legal fees and allows more residents to access professional advice. For many, Navigating the System with a Hennepin County Public Defender is the first step toward resolving legal matters without financial strain. Public defenders are familiar with local court procedures, which can be valuable in building a defense strategy.
At the same time, there are challenges, such as high caseloads and limited time for each case. These factors can affect how much attention each client receives.
